Uganda - Re-Export of Tapered Roller Bearings, Including Cone and Tapered Roller Assemblies

Since 2014, Uganda Re-Export of Tapered Roller Bearings, Including Cone and Tapered Roller Assemblies fell by 67.3% year on year. With $93 in 2019, the country was ranked number 28 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Tapered Roller Bearings, Including Cone and Tapered Roller Assemblies. Uganda is overtaken by Barbados, which was number 27 at $125 and is followed by Trinidad and Tobago with $34. United States topped the ranking with $85,271,122.62 in 2019, +5.9% versus 2018. United Arab Emirates, Canada and Kuwait resp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. United Arab Emirates witnessed the best average annual growth at +32.2% per year, while Jamaica recorded the worst performance at -71.8% per year.
